What are AI Insights?
As outlined earlier, AI insights leverage data to provide a deeper understanding of market behavior, customer preferences, and operational inefficiencies. Using AI technologies such as machine learning and data mining, businesses can convert raw data into valuable insights.
Types of AI Insights:
Predictive Insights: These insights help forecast future trends based on historical data. For instance, retailers can predict peak shopping seasons or demand for certain products.
Descriptive Insights: This type offers a summary of past actions and current status. Businesses can analyze their sales performance over a specific period to gauge their growth.
Prescriptive Insights: These insights recommend actions based on data analysis. For example, a marketing team can be advised to target a specific demographic for a campaign based on purchasing trends.
By using AI insights, businesses can stay ahead of the curve, ensuring they make data-driven decisions. Clients can tap into these insights for strategic planning and enhancing their overall performance.

Enhancing Customer Experience
One of the most significant impacts of AI in business is its ability to enhance customer experience. Companies can analyze customer data to understand their preferences better and tailor services accordingly.
Personalization: AI algorithms can analyze user behavior across platforms to create personalized experiences. Netflix, for example, uses AI to recommend shows and movies based on users' viewing habits, which keeps customers engaged longer.
Chatbots and Virtual Assistants: Many businesses are employing AI-powered chatbots to handle customer inquiries and support. These chatbots can provide instant answers to user questions, freeing up human agents for more complex issues. According to a report by Juniper Research, chatbots are projected to save businesses over $8 billion annually by 2022.
Feedback Analysis: Companies can use AI to analyze customer feedback from various channels, including social media, surveys, and reviews. AI can sift through this data to determine sentiments and trends, helping businesses understand their customers better and adapt promptly.
By focusing on improving customer experiences with AI, businesses can reap long-term benefits and forge stronger connections with their client base.
Streamlining Operations
AI is a powerful tool for streamlining operations within businesses, leading to improved efficiency and productivity. Automation of mundane tasks allows employees to focus on more strategic roles, ultimately driving growth.
Supply Chain Optimization: AI can analyze vast amounts of data to identify inefficiencies within supply chains, making recommendations for improvement. For instance, predictive analytics can forecast inventory needs, reducing waste and costs.
Employee Management: AI tools can assist in workforce management by predicting staffing needs based on data such as customer footfall or historical sales. This ensures adequate staffing levels, enhancing overall service delivery.
Fraud Detection: In financial sectors, AI algorithms can process transactions in real-time, flagging any that deviate from normal patterns for immediate investigation. This not only protects the business but also fosters trust among customers.
The integration of AI into operational processes allows companies to maximize productivity and allocate resources more effectively.
Data-Driven Marketing Strategies
AI is revolutionizing how businesses approach marketing. With the ability to analyze data at scale, companies can create targeted marketing strategies that yield better results.
Audience Segmentation: AI can analyze customer data to identify distinct segments within the audience. This allows businesses to tailor their marketing messages, improving engagement rates.
Content Optimization: AI tools can analyze the performance of various content types and recommend the most effective strategies for reaching target audiences. For example, AI can suggest the best times to post on social media or tailor email marketing campaigns based on individual customer behavior.
Performance Analysis: Businesses can use AI to evaluate the effectiveness of their marketing efforts. By measuring key performance indicators (KPIs), companies can adjust strategies in real-time, ensuring optimal returns on investment.
By integrating AI into marketing practices, businesses can make informed decisions that lead to successful campaigns and a stronger market presence.
